I try to permanently merge one adjustment layer with multiple layers below. Preview and final merge result are different. AP 2.3.0 on iMac Pro 2.3GHz 18 core running Ventura 13.6.1.

Picture 1-2. Group of layers with adjustment layer affecting all layers in the group. Picture 1 with adjustment layer off.

Picture 2 with adjustment layer on. Adjustment is showing on all layers. So far so good.

Picture 3. Clicked merge on the levels adjustment layer (adjustment layer disappears), but the adjustment is only applied to top layer. ??? The preview adjustments are not carried through to all layers below. It does not matter whether I put the layers in group or not.

I have to duplicate adjustment layer (command-J), drag it down on top of each layer (or make it a child layer), then merge each adjustment layer individually. Rather convoluted. How can I apply the adjustment layers to all layers below, to get the preview effect permanently? I fully understand the advantages of on-the-fly adjustment layers. Here I want to permanently burn it in, but keep elements in separate layers (merging image layers, then separating elements again is not the solution). Thanks.

Instead of using an adjustment layer, which will not work for you the way you want it too

Use Develop Persona...

  • Select all the layers
  • Click on the Develop Persona Icon
  • Adjust the exposure levels, see image below for possible exposure settings and then hit Develop.

This will change all the layers but still keep them separate.

Thanks firstdefense. Tried it. It sort of works. However, the adjustment layer cannot be taken over to Develop persona. Additionally if I select multiple layers in Photo, then go to Develop, only the top layer is showing in Develop. So fine adjustments that take subtleties in each layer into account, are not possible. I guess I could write down the values determined in Photo, take those to Develop and numerically adjust. But particularly Levels is not available in Develop. Could get equivalent effects with other adjustments, but those are not necessarily available in Photo.

So while the Develop approach works with multiple layers, it has other issues. Not a good, clean solution either, sorry!

My main surprise is the preview and merge are not giving same result in Photo. Very odd.

If you layout the images in an array you will see them all and so you will see the realtime effects of the adjust but you also have Curves under the Tone Tab and any adjustments can be saved to a preset if you have similar images but the oddity is there are no numerical co-ordinates for the curve tab so it's guesswork if you want to mimic a curves adjustment from Photos pixel persona. So in the last image I posted, all those layers were visible and all the images on those layers were editable with exposure and curves., you can also isolate any of those images by using the overlay tab.

I know this isn't ideal but unfortunately until an adjustment filter can be merged to a group of layers it's the only solution I can think of unless anyone else has a better workflow.

Forgot to add you can also use the Details tab to increase the detail and reduce noise which can give a nice effect.
